What are the responsibilities and job description for the Shipping and Receiving Clerk position at Staffing Texas, LLC?
Job Summary
Primary responsibilities are managing the daily office activities of the manufacturing plant. These essential duties include:
· inbound and outbound freight shipments
· inventory management and cycle counts
· ordering shop supplies
· confirmation accurate count of receivables
· keeping accurate shipment records
· reporting working hours and payroll for shop personnel
· confirmation and accuracy of shop invoices, job completion and billing
· quality control management
· coordinating shipments to jobsites and confirmation of jobsite deliveries by communicating with the Ace service department and/or the customer.
· Create, organize and send operation and maintenance manuals to customers.
· Other duties may be included.

Work Environment and Equipment Used
This job operates in a professional office in the plant area. Must be comfortable using computers and fluent using Microsoft Office, Word, and Excel. Safety requirements while in the plant are ear plugs, steel-toed shoes, and safety glasses. Shop noise such as forklifts and heavy equipment are a regular occurrence. Required attendance and involvement in weekly safety meetings with the shop personnel.
Physical Demands
Non-material handling:
· Bending: Frequent. Various bending and low-level positions are performed while working.
· Squatting: Frequent. Various positions required.
· Kneeling: Frequent. Various positions required.
· Balance: Continuous.
· Hand controls: Occasional. Hand controls are used for testing and operating machinery.
· Standing/Walking: Frequent.
· Fine motor coordination/manual dexterity: Frequent.
· Occasional forklift operation
Material handling:
· Lifting floor to waist: Occasional. Lifting may be performed at all levels.
· Preparing parts for shipment includes boxing and packing.
· Pushing/pulling: Occasional.
· Physical demand is light (according to the dictionary of occupational titles).
